Football or Basketball??

(Clarion Ledger)OXFORD — The Ole Miss’ men’s basketball teams two newest players — Greg Hardy and Shay Hodge — won’t be in uniform when the Rebels (6-1) play New Orleans (2-5) in Tad Smith Coliseum on Thursday.Coach Andy Kennedy said the football players will be concentrating on academics the rest of the fall semester. They will continue practicing with the team, but will not dress out or play until the semester ends.“We’re going to get through this academic quarter just to make sure they’re on point academically,” Kennedy said. “We didn’t want to take them away from their academic responsibilities. That’s priority No. 1.”Both players began practicing Monday, two days after the football season wrapped up with a 20-17 win against Mississippi State in the Egg Bowl. Both were two-sport stars in high school and Kennedy said they’ll be given a chance to help the Rebels this season.Kennedy said the earliest they’ll be able to play will be on Dec. 9, when the Rebels play at Memphis.“We’re just so new into this, I want to give them an opportunity,” Kennedy said. “We’re still learning about one another.”In addition, running back Mico McSwain practiced on Tuesday and said he was practicing again today when he walked into Tad Smith Coliseum. But Kennedy said McSwain “won’t be a part” of the team.
